Published Softwares

A.    Computational Tools Developed

1.      Low-Re based k-epsilon turbulence models for flow and heat transfer in separated flows

2.      Finite-volume based CFD model for diffusion flame dynamics in aerosol reactor

3.      Volume-of-fluid (VOF) based interface tracking models in two-phase immiscible fluids

4.      Solid mechanics model to study residuals in low-alloy steel weldments

5.      Finite-volume based CFD codes (2D and 3D) to study laminar/turbulent fluid flow and heat transfer with phase change applications (GTAW and GMAW)

 

B.     Materials Algorithms Project (http://www.msm.cam.ac.uk/map/)

1.      MAP_KINETICS_HAZ_MICROSTRUCTURES (J. Jaidi, H. K. D. H. Bhadeshia, 2003): Program to forecast the development of microstructure in heat-affected zone (HAZ) of low-alloy steel weldments: 

(http://www.msm.cam.ac.uk/map/kinetics/programs/haz_microstructure.html)

2.      MAP_KINETICS_GRAINGROWTH_WELD4 (J. Jaidi, 2002): Program to calculate average grain size in heat-affected zone (HAZ) in the presence of dissolving precipitates during welding:

(http://www.msm.cam.ac.uk/map/kinetics/programs/ags4.html)

3.   MAP_KINETICS_GRAINGROWTH_WELD3 (J. Jaidi, 2002): Program to calculate average grain size in HAZ in the presence of growing precipitates during welding: (http://www.msm.cam.ac.uk/map/kinetics/programs/ags3.html)

4.   MAP_KINETICS_GRAINGROWTH_WELD2 (J. Jaidi, 2002): Program to calculate average grain size in HAZ in the presence of stable particles during welding:

       (http://www.msm.cam.ac.uk/map/kinetics/programs/ags2.html)
